Easter Egg Booking Game
You will need some plastic fillable eggs - Spotlight has them on special this week, 12 for $1.99
Take six (or use all 12) plastic eggs and fill each one with a little gift (maybe a sample if you have one that will fit, a choccie, a $5 off voucher - you choose)
In 1/2 of the eggs write on a piece of paper "Congratulations! You have won a <( Insert Company name here )> show!!!" and place it inside with the gift.
Seal the eggs with tape and put them in a basket in full view of everyone.
Before you end the night that evening ask if anyone likes to gamble. If so, maybe she would like to take a chance on winning something. Tempt your guests by telling them that their chances of winning are 100%!
Tip: Make sure your guests understand that if they choose an egg they must be willing to book a show with you.

At the end of your party, show a plate of choc easter eggs (you know the foil ones you get in 18pks at kmart)!
Before hand you need to get some small squares of paper and write some discounts/free gifts you are willing to give -
Let's Party 5% off $1 off Free shipping Choose a gift from my basket
Fold the paper up and tape to the bottom of the egg, now arrange the eggs so you can't see the paper.
Let the guests know that half of them say "Let's Party!" If they chose that one, they must book a party. Otherwise, they get whatever is on the bottom of the chocolate. They can choose as many as they want, but must book tonight if they hit "Let's Party!"
Anyone who plays is most likely willing to book, and chocolate is always a good incentive! Author: RachelSaucy
